> Hum, I'm surprized the PID file is removed only in lxcDomainUndefine.
> The PID file need to be re-created each time the domain is started. But
> a domain could be started and stopped many time while being defined,
> what happen in a (define/start/stop/start) sequence ? Looks to me the
> O_CREAT flag in the second start would break because the PID file is still
> here ...
>
> Maybe I'm just wrong but if you could just double check that scenario before
> the commit, that would be nice :-)
>
> Daniel
>
O_CREAT just causes the file to be created if it doesn't exist. O_EXCL will
trigger an error if the file already exists.
I'd considered removing it after killing the tty process but don't recall now
why I didn't do that. I think it makes sense to do that so I'll make the change
with the ones from Jim and Dan.
